Mississippi Delta Community College
Mississippi Delta Community College District
Mississippi Delta Community College is a highly-regarded public institution serving the Greenville area with comprehensive trade programs. It features state-of-the-art training facilities, experienced instructors, and strong industry partnerships that lead to high job placement rates. Students benefit from hands-on learning, industry certifications, and affordable tuition, with programs designed to meet local workforce needs in welding, automotive, HVAC, and other skilled trades.

Are there any specialized certifications I can earn through Greenville, MS trade schools that are particularly valuable in the local job market?
Yes, Greenville trade schools offer certifications that are highly valued locally, including AWS welding certifications, EPA Section 608 HVAC certification, and ASE automotive certifications. These credentials are particularly sought after by Greenville's manufacturing sector, agricultural equipment companies, and commercial facilities that require skilled technicians for maintenance and repair operations throughout the Mississippi Delta region.
